Sennen Potash Provides Results of NI 43-101 Technical Report on its Monument Project in Utah, USA

Mr. Ian Rozier, President and CEO of Sennen Potash Corporation is pleased to provide a summary of the results of the National Instrument 43-101 Technical Report on its Monument Potash Project in Utah, USA.

Sennen commissioned North Rim Exploration Ltd. to complete a Mineral Resource Estimate as part of the Report. The Report was prepared by Ms. Tabetha Stirrett, P.Geo, and Ms. Debbie Shewfelt, M.Sc., P.Geo, of North Rim.

In a news release dated January 15, 2015, Sennen reported initial results from its Johnson 1 Well (the "Johnson Well"). The highlights were as follows:

  • High grade of 46.1% KCl (29.1% K2O) over 6.3 m (20.6 ft), the Upper bed in Cycle 18 of the Paradox Formation.
  • Ambient temperature over intersected potash zone of 68°C (154°F).
  • The high ambient temperatures are favorable for solution mining.
  • The existence of a second potash bed ("Lower Potash Bed").
  • Strong continuity of the potash beds across the Monument project area.
  • These initial results have been refined by further technical analyses and by the Mineral Resource Estimate.
